Murrelektronik’s new control cabinet component communicates with the plant operators via text message. It provides current machine operating conditions with a short message. And the operator can control the outputs via text message!
A SIM card is inserted into MIRO GSM enabling communication with the cellular network. Six inputs can be connected per device (e.g. switches or sensors) and the limits are defined with a configuration software.
If the set values are reached, MIRO GSM will automatically send a text message with a predefined text. For each input, you decide if text message is sent to one or several recipients. It is also possible to have active responses: you send a text message to MIRO GSM and the module will answer the text message, for example, by giving the current operating temperature of a machine
If needed, the plant operator can switch four relay outputs with a text message over the MIRO GSM network
